The worst thing about Julie Sharpe's new life as a single mom was the loneliness. Every night, after her daughter went to bed, it was as if the outside world ceased to exist. Being a mother would always be her top priority, but the human body doesn’t come with an off switch. Telling herself she didn’t miss adult conversation or physical affection didn't make it true. She was becoming isolated and depressed and, the truth is, being alone for so long was making her miserable to the point of desperation…and desperation leads to some really bad choices.

An erotic, page turning thriller, REGRET, proves once again that Timothy Allen Smith is a master story teller absolutely at the top of his game.
